Todo sobre Apple, Android, Juegos Apks y Sitios de Peliculas

5 Soluciones efectivas para corregir el error 500 interno del servidor en WordPress

Conseguir Error del servidor interno de WordPress 500 después de cambiar la URL? O, de repente, un sitio que funcionaba perfectamente hace apenas unos segundos y ahora aparece un error interno del servidor. Este es un error común de WordPress que encontrará como editor de WordPress. Y las causas más comunes de este error son un archivo .htaccess dañado y exceder el límite de memoria PHP de su servidor. si es el propietario del sitio, desarrollador web o editor de WordPress aquí 5 soluciones para arreglar el Error interno de servidor 500 para que pueda hacer que su sitio de WordPress vuelva a funcionar lo más rápido posible.

El código de estado 500 (Error interno del servidor) indica que el servidor encontró una condición inesperada que le impidió cumplir con la solicitud.

Solucionar el error interno del servidor en WordPress

Note: Estas soluciones requieren realizar muchos cambios en el directorio raíz de su sitio. Se recomienda encarecidamente que haga una copia de seguridad de su sitio antes de probar cualquiera de estas soluciones en caso de que algo salga mal.

Crea un nuevo archivo .htaccess

Las causas más comunes de este error son un archivo .htaccess dañado y exceder el límite de memoria PHP de su servidor. El archivo .htaccess en su directorio de WordPress puede dañarse después de instalar un complemento o realizar otro cambio en su sitio de WordPress. La solución es sencilla. Todo lo que necesitas hacer es crear un nuevo archivo .htaccess en el directorio raíz de WordPress.

  1. Si tiene acceso a Cpanel, abra el directorio raíz de WordPress desde la herramienta de administración de archivos,
  2. O puede utilizar el software de terceros Filezilla para acceder al directorio raíz de WordPress.

Cambie el nombre del archivo .htaccess como “.htaccess_old”.

  • Accedamos al Administrador de archivos directamente desde el panel de cPanel:
  • Busque el archivo .htaccess en la raíz de su sitio.
  • Haga clic derecho y elija Cambiar nombre:
  • Cambie el nombre a algo como “.htaccess_old”.
  • Ahora, todo lo que necesitas hacer es crear un nuevo archivo .htaccess para reemplazarlo.

Genere un nuevo archivo .htaccess.

  • Para forzar a WordPress a generar un nuevo archivo .htaccess,
  • vaya a su panel de WordPress.
  • Luego, navegue hasta Configuración → Enlaces permanentes.
  • No es necesario cambiar ninguna configuración.
  • Simplemente haga clic en el botón Guardar cambios,
  • Y WordPress generará automáticamente un archivo .htaccess nuevo y limpio:
  • ¡Eso es todo! Con suerte, su sitio está funcionando nuevamente.

Compruebe si algún complemento de WP defectuoso está causando el problema

Si el problema no se resuelve y sigue apareciendo Error interno de servidor 500 Lo siguiente que puedes intentar es desactivar tus complementos. A menudo, los problemas o conflictos con los complementos pueden provocar un error interno del servidor. Especialmente si vio el error inmediatamente después de activar un nuevo complemento. Y al desactivar sus complementos, puede encontrar el complemento problemático y eliminarlo.

Si tiene acceso al Panel de WordPress, vaya al área de administración de complementos y use la casilla de verificación para desactivar todos sus complementos a la vez:

Y luego reactivarlos uno por uno y abrir la página web después de cada uno. Con suerte, encontrará el complemento problemático.

Desactive los complementos de WordPress si no puede acceder a su panel de control:

Si debido a este error interno del servidor 500 no puede acceder a su panel aquí, siga los pasos a continuación para desactivar los complementos del administrador de archivos.

  • Conéctese a su sitio a través de FTP o Administrador de archivos
  • Navegue hasta la carpeta /wp-content/.
  • Cambie el nombre de la carpeta de complementos a algo como plugins_old.

Ahora intente abrir su panel de WordPress y, si puede acceder, significa que el problema es uno de los complementos.

  • Vaya a la sección Complementos de su WordPress,
  • mostrará el error “el complemento ha sido desactivado debido a un error; El archivo de complemento no existe”. No te preocupes.
  • Vaya al administrador de archivos y cambie el nombre de la carpeta de complementos de plugins_old a complementos.
  • Ahora, desde el panel de WordPress, active cada complemento uno por uno.
  • Después de activar un complemento, busque 3-4 páginas de tu blog.
  • Repita este paso hasta que encuentre un complemento cuya activación provoque el error interno del servidor.

Switch a un tema predeterminado

Si desactivar tus complementos no resolvió el problema, es probable que tu tema sea el culpable. Puede verificar esto fácilmente cambiando a un tema predeterminado de WordPress. Recomiendo usar Twenty Sixteen, que es el último tema predeterminado. Si cambiar a Twenty Sixteen resuelve el problema, puedes volver a habilitar todos los complementos y comenzar a trabajar para encontrar el problema en el código de tu tema.

Si su tema proviene del repositorio de temas oficial o de una tienda de temas independiente, debe informarle al autor lo antes posible. Si, por el contrario, es tu propio tema, necesitarás la ayuda de un desarrollador, porque estos errores a menudo pueden ser muy difíciles de encontrar, incluso para programadores experimentados.

Aumentar el límite de memoria de PHP

Otro problema potencial es que su sitio de WordPress esté alcanzando su Límite de memoria PHP. De forma predeterminada, WordPress intenta asignar 40 MB de memoria para instalaciones de un solo sitio (siempre que su servidor lo permita). Pero si tiene dificultades, puede aumentar manualmente este límite (nuevamente, siempre que su proveedor de alojamiento lo permita).

Acceda al directorio raíz de WordPress a través de FTP o el Administrador de archivos de cPanel:

Buscar wp-config.php archivo haga clic derecho y seleccione editar

Agregue la siguiente línea de código justo antes del /* Eso es todo, ¡deja de editar! Feliz publicación. */ mensaje:

definir (‘WP_MEMORY_LIMIT’, ’64M’);

Luego guarde los cambios presionando el botón Guardar. O puedes comunicarte con tu anfitrión para que te ayude con esto. Ahora compruebe si esto soluciona el error interno del servidor 500.

Vuelva a cargar los archivos principales de WordPress

Si ninguna de las soluciones anteriores funciona para usted, intente cargar una copia limpia de los archivos principales de WordPress.

ir a WordPress.org y descargue la última versión de WordPress.

Una vez que finalice la descarga, extraiga el archivo ZIP y elimine:

  • Toda la carpeta wp-content.
  • archivo wp-config-sample.php.

Luego, cargue todos los archivos restantes a su sitio de WordPress a través de FTP. Su programa FTP le mostrará un mensaje sobre archivos duplicados. Cuando esto suceda, asegúrese de elegir la opción Sobrescribir archivos duplicados.

Espero que una de estas soluciones le haya ayudado a corregir el mensaje de error del servidor interno en su sitio de WordPress. De lo contrario, le recomendamos que solicite al equipo de soporte de su proveedor de alojamiento que revise los registros de errores con usted para identificar el problema.

Resumen del Contenido